biosecurity in pigs is a crucial aspect of livestock management that focuses on preventing the introduction and spread of diseases within pig populations. Implementing strict biosecurity measures is essential for pig farmers to safeguard the health and welfare of their animals, protect their investment, and minimize the risk of disease outbreaks. In this article, we will explore the significance of biosecurity in pigs and discuss key strategies that farmers can adopt to enhance biosecurity on their farms.
Pigs are highly susceptible to a variety of diseases, including viral, bacterial, and parasitic infections that can have devastating consequences on herd health and productivity. These diseases can spread rapidly within a herd through various routes, such as direct animal-to-animal contact, contaminated feed and water, insects, wildlife, and human visitors. Without proper biosecurity protocols in place, pigs are at risk of contracting and spreading harmful pathogens, leading to increased mortality rates, reduced growth rates, and economic losses for pig farmers.
One of the primary goals of biosecurity in pigs is to prevent the introduction of diseases onto the farm. This can be achieved by controlling access to the farm premises and minimizing the risk of external sources of contamination. Farmers should implement strict biosecurity measures, such as limiting the movement of animals onto the farm, screening new arrivals for diseases, and quarantining sick or recently purchased pigs to prevent the spread of infections.
Additionally, biosecurity measures should be in place to prevent the spread of diseases within the herd. This includes maintaining strict hygiene practices, such as regular cleaning and disinfection of animal housing and equipment, as well as providing adequate ventilation and waste management to reduce the buildup of pathogens. It is also important to monitor pig health regularly, promptly isolate sick animals, and implement appropriate treatment protocols to prevent the spread of infectious diseases.
Furthermore, biosecurity in pigs involves controlling the movement of people and vehicles onto the farm premises. Farmers should establish designated entry points, provide protective clothing and footwear for visitors, and require all personnel to adhere to strict hygiene protocols, such as washing hands and wearing gloves before entering pig facilities. By limiting the access of unauthorized individuals and vehicles, farmers can reduce the risk of introducing diseases onto the farm and protect the health of their pigs.
In addition to implementing physical barriers and hygiene protocols, pig farmers can also utilize biosecurity practices to manage disease risks in feed and water sources. Contaminated feed and water can serve as vectors for disease transmission, so farmers should ensure that feed ingredients are sourced from reputable suppliers, stored in clean and secure containers, and regularly tested for contaminants. Water sources should also be protected from contamination by wildlife, insects, and other external sources to prevent the spread of diseases among pigs.
Effective biosecurity in pigs requires a combination of preventative measures, ongoing monitoring, and regular evaluation of biosecurity protocols to identify and address any weaknesses or gaps. Farmers should work closely with veterinarians, animal health professionals, and industry experts to develop and implement comprehensive biosecurity plans tailored to their specific farm conditions and herd requirements. By integrating biosecurity practices into daily farm management routines and training farm personnel on biosecurity protocols, pig farmers can minimize the risk of disease outbreaks and protect the health and welfare of their animals.
Overall, biosecurity in pigs is essential for maintaining a healthy and productive herd, reducing the risk of disease transmission, and ensuring the sustainability of pig farming operations. By implementing strict biosecurity measures, pig farmers can safeguard the health and welfare of their animals, protect their investment, and contribute to the overall biosecurity of the swine industry. With proper planning, education, and commitment to biosecurity principles, pig farmers can successfully mitigate disease risks and promote the long-term viability of their operations.
